FightFeed: Catch Every MMA Moment on Reddit Stream
Mixed Martial Arts (MMA) has surged in popularity over the past few decades, captivating millions of fans worldwide with its...
Mixed Martial Arts (MMA) has surged in popularity over the past few decades, captivating millions of fans worldwide with its...